New Large Denomination Bills Available in Cuba
Cuban large denomination bills of 200, 500 and 1000 pesos began circulating on Sunday, in order to facilitate transactions in Cuban currency (CUP) and in dollar stores (TRD) as announced by the Central Bank of Cuba (BCC).»

Raul Castro Stressed Need to End Blockade for Further Relations with USA
President Raul Castro suggested that U.S.-Cuba relations will not fully improved until the economic giant lifts its 50-year blockade of Cuba. President Castro made the remarks in the opening session of the two-day Latin American and Caribbean States (CELAC) summit in Costa Rica. CELAC is a coalition of the 33 Latin American and Caribbean nations, representing around 600 million people. »
